Tribe and State: The Dynamics of International Politics and the Reign of Zimri-Lim - Gorgias Studies in the Ancient Near East Adam Miglio
Tribe and State: The Dynamics of International Politics and the Reign of Zimri-Lim - Gorgias Studies in the Ancient Near East
Adam Miglio
This book analyzes Zimri-Lim’s interactions with sovereigns from the Habur and with Yamut-bal and Numha tribal polities. It describes how Zimri-Lim’s disproportionate dependence on tribal connections left him vulnerable when these alliances began to falter in his tenth regnal year.
